What's Involved?
If you’ve ever visited Heartwood, you’ll remember the stately maple forest that surrounds the cidery. Every season has its charm, but the transition from winter's dormancy to spring's emergence is one of our favourites: the maple sap is flowing, the sugar shack is cooking, and signs of life are everywhere. The Sugarbush Retreat Day offers a chance to step outside of the hustle of daily work and the uncertainties marking this moment in time. It's a time to reconnect with the simple wonders of a world that faithfully shows up each spring. Being on the land and connecting to the seasons is a balm for the soul. The retreat will offer participants a chance to wander the forest, reflecting on how dormancy and emergence appear in our own lives; we will prepare and eat a sugarbush lunch together, and explore these themes in conversation with each other. And of course, you'll get involved in the sticky work of collecting sap, boiling it over the fire, and bottling the finished maple syrup to take home.
